Transaction 6f74ac81de850052efdad02768d69d4f43699518b8aeb84365dd3fd376a6773b
1 Input
1 Output
-
6f74ac81de850052efdad02768d69d4f43699518b8aeb84365dd3fd376a6773b:0
- value
- 17541474
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b939ec2fa7b18c2a0fecafe0c469b3c746ff53b7322c704f012809ec7309e5af
- address
- bc1phyu7cta8kxxz5rlv4lsvg6dncar075ahxgk8qncp9qy7cucfukhst3q0xg